Revelation 3:15
jI know thy works, that kthou art neither cold nor hot: I would thou wert cold or hot.
I know thy works, that thou art neither cold nor hot: I would thou wert cold or hot.
Οἶδά σου τὰ ἔργα, ὅτι οὔτε ψυχρὸς εἶ οὔτε ζεστός· ὄφελον ψυχρὸς εἴης ἢ ζεστός.
